How Thermal Imaging Leak Detection Works

Our thermal imaging leak detection process is designed to be thorough and efficient, helping you avoid costly repairs and prevent further damage. We’ll use specialized equipment to detect even the smallest leaks, and work with you to identify and repair the source of the problem.

Step 1: Inspection

Our technicians will use thermal imaging cameras to scan your property for signs of leaks, checking for temperature differences that could show water damage.

Step 2: Leak Detection

Once we’ve identified potential leaks, we’ll use specialized sensors to detect the source of the problem, helping you pinpoint the exact location of the issue.

Step 3: Repair

Our team will work with you to repair the source of the leak, using the latest techniques and materials to ensure a safe and secure fix.

Step 4: Drying and Cleanup

Finally, we’ll use specialized equipment to dry out the affected area and clean up any remaining water or debris.

Warning Signs You Need Thermal Imaging Leak Detection

Ignoring warning signs can lead to costly repairs and health hazards, making it essential to catch problems early. Here are some common warning signs that show you need thermal imaging leak detection: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ors can show the presence of mold and mildew, which can be hazardous to your health.

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ls

Visible water stains can show a leak, but even small water spots can be a sign of a bigger issue.

Cracked or Warped Flooring

Cracked or warped flooring can show a leak, but also be a sign of structural damage.

High Water Bills

Unexpected increases in your water bill can show a hidden leak, which can cause significant damage over time.

Warped or Buckled Ceiling Tiles

Warped or buckled ceiling tiles can show a leak, but also be a sign of structural damage.

Unpleasant Sounds

Unusual sounds, such as dripping or running water, can show a leak, but also be a sign of structural damage.

Thermal Imaging Leak Detection Cost in Marysville, WA

The cost of thermal imaging leak detection varies based on the severity and size of the affected area, as well as local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for our services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Thermal imaging leak detection $500 – $2,500 Severity and size of the affected area, as well as local conditions
Leak detection and repair $1,500 – $5,000 Severity and size of the affected area, as well as local conditions
Drying and cleanup $500 – $2,000 Size and complexity of the affected area
Water damage restoration $2,000 – $10,000 Severity and size of the affected area, as well as local conditions
Asbestos or lead paint removal $1,000 – $5,000 Size and complexity of the affected area
Electronics repair or replacement $500 – $2,000 Severity and size of the affected area, as well as local conditions

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ment, and we offer free estimates to help you budget for your thermal imaging leak detection service.
